Two Miscellaneous Cards


I have gotten to spend a lot of time in my stamping room the last week or so, and it's been great! Still using up old things, though. I haven't even used my Gina K purchases that I bought at her Fourth of July sale!! Soon, I hope.

The flowers on this first card are from Gina K - stamps, stencils and dies. The sentiment is also from Gina K. The big flower and sentiment are popped up. I added a thin strip of purple and also black above the patterned panel.


The die-cut piece on this card was still in my die when I went to put it away. (It was used for my card from Tuesday.) The black frame was in my parts. I let some of the flower pieces hang out of the frame. It was so plain so I added some doodling and lines with a white gel pen. Not terrible happy with this card, but maybe someone will like it.
